Sri Lanka Chief Selector Asantha De Mel Rushed to Hospital, discharged later

Written by Sumit Seth

Asantha De Mel, Sri Lanka Chief Selector, was rushed to a Kandy hospital on Tuesday after complaining chest pain and later discharged following the checkup, Cricket Age reliably learns.

Following a whitewash in the recently concluded ODI series, Sri Lanka are scheduled to play Two T20Is against West Indies, as first match will take place tomorrow at Pallekele.

According to sources, Asantha found blood pressure bit high in the morning and was immediately rushed to the hospital by the ambulance.

“He has been discharged after some tests and now is back to hotel” a team insider told Cricket Age.
